Achieving submicron positioning in optical alignment applications is critical in the production of optical components and systems used in the consumer electronics, automotive, and defense industries. Precision motion control solutions, including direct-drive stages and hexapods, play a key role in optimizing active alignment processes and ensuring quality through repeatable results. However, selecting the right positioning system is not always easy. This webinar will provide a technical overview of six-degrees-of-freedom (6-DOF) positioning architectures and their effect on alignment quality. It will examine the role of active alignment algorithms and control systems on alignment quality and repeatability. Additionally, it will examine real-world case studies that highlight trade-offs between different motion control technologies and demonstrate strategies for maximizing throughput while maintaining alignment integrity. Designed for optical engineers, automation engineers, and manufacturing engineers, this webinar will equip attendees with the knowledge required to make informed decisions when specifying motion control solutions for optical alignment applications.
